About This Color

PANTONE 11-2-2 U is a moderately saturated orange with medium tonality. Its HEX value is #A96E44, placing it in the orange region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 25°.

This mid-range tone offers excellent versatility, working in both digital interfaces and print applications. It provides strong visual impact while maintaining readability when paired with light or dark text.
